Securing recognition for your cover songs in today's online landscape can be a daunting task. While there are plenty of platforms available, selecting the right ones to showcase your skills is important.
Developing a loyal following often starts with regular uploads and connecting with listeners. Don't underestimate the power of marketing on social media, partnering with other musicians, and submitting your music to blogs and playlists. Remember, recognition rarely comes overnight.
- Focus on creating high-quality recordings.
- Research different distribution platforms and their audiences.
- Connect with your fans and build a community around your music.

Unlocking Success: Distributing Your Songs Like a Pro rock
Ready to release your music to the world? Getting your songs effectively is crucial for building an audience and reaching listeners. It's not just about uploading your tracks; it's about strategically setting them on the right platforms, crafting compelling previews, and optimizing your presence to resonate with fans.
- First choose the channels that suit your genre and target audience.
- Consider popular streaming services like Spotify, Apple Music, and YouTube Music.
- Build a strong online presence by actively communicating with fans on social media.
Remember carefully about your song's metadata. Clear, interesting titles and descriptions are key to attracting listeners.
